One Year After Osama bin Laden’s Death, You Can Read About His Plans — Find Out How
The Combating Terrorism Center at West Point will release some of the 6,000 documents that were seized in last year’s raid of Osama bin Laden’s compound in Abbottabad, Pakistan, resulting in his death one year ago Wednesday. This is the first time the general public will have access to the al Qaeda leader’s papers.
